Aichi Prefectural Art Theater Artistic Director. Graduated from Ochanomizu University, Faculty of Letters and Education, Department of Dance Education, and completed the Graduate School of Humanities and Sciences of the same university. After a career on the stage, Karatsu worked at the Aichi Arts Center as Japan's first dance curator from 1993. She received the first Asahi Arts Award at the Aichi Cultural Information Center in 2000. She has been in her current position since 2021. She was the performing arts curator for the Aichi Triennale from 2010 to 2016. She has produced and invited over 200 productions and projects ranging from large-scale international co-productions to experimental performances. Upon the establishment of DaBY, she became actively involved in improving the overall environment for dance and performing arts, advocating for the rights of artists, dancers, and staff, and implementing measures to expand audiences and markets. She is the Director of SEGA SAMMY Arts Foundation. Her written work includes her book, L'intelligence du corps. She received the 73rd Minister of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ology's Art Encouragement Prize in 2022.
